Choosing the Right Base for Your Mask

The first step in creating a DIY skincare mask is selecting the right base ingredient. The base serves as the foundation of your mask and provides the texture and consistency that will make it easy to apply and nourish your skin. One of the most popular choices for a base is yogurt, which is not only soothing and hydrating but also contains lactic acid that helps to exfoliate and brighten the skin. Alternatively, you can use honey, which is a natural humectant that locks in moisture and has antibacterial properties that can help to prevent acne and breakouts.

Boosting Your Mask with Active Ingredients

Once you have chosen your base ingredient, it’s time to add in some active ingredients that will target specific skin concerns. For those looking to combat acne and inflammation, adding a few drops of tea tree oil can help to reduce redness and kill acne-causing bacteria. If you’re aiming to brighten and even out your skin tone, consider mixing in some turmeric, a powerful antioxidant that can help to fade dark spots and hyperpigmentation. For those with dry or sensitive skin, adding a few drops of jojoba oil or aloe vera gel can provide much-needed hydration and soothing relief.

Enhancing Your Mask with Essential Oils

To elevate the sensory experience of using your DIY skincare mask, consider incorporating a few drops of essential oils that not only smell divine but also offer additional skincare benefits. Lavender essential oil is known for its calming properties and can help to reduce stress and promote relaxation while also soothing irritated skin. Rosemary essential oil is another great option, as it has antibacterial and anti-inflammatory properties that can help to clear up acne and improve circulation, giving your skin a healthy glow.

Customizing Your Mask for Your Skin Type

One of the great advantages of creating your own DIY skincare mask is the ability to customize it to suit your unique skin type. If you have oily or acne-prone skin, you may want to add in some bentonite clay, a powerful detoxifier that can help to draw out impurities and unclog pores. On the other hand, if you have dry or mature skin, you might opt for ingredients like avocado or almond oil, which are rich in vitamins and fatty acids that can nourish and hydrate the skin.

Indulge in a Spa-Like Experience

Once you have mixed together your chosen ingredients to create a smooth paste, it’s time to indulge in a spa-like experience and apply the mask to your clean, dry skin. Using clean hands or a brush, spread a thin, even layer of the mask over your face, avoiding the delicate eye area. Take this opportunity to relax and unwind as the mask works its magic, leaving it on for about 10-15 minutes or until it starts to dry. Rinse off the mask with lukewarm water, pat your skin dry, and follow up with your favorite moisturizer to lock in the benefits of the mask.
